Default Fuel range has disappeared from app

As per the title, see pic. Average fuel consumption is also missing which is possibly why the range can't be calculated. However, the fuel consumption for individual journeys is showing correctly.

I haven't seen any posts about D5 or T6 cars having this problem. Anyone?
